How Our Water Damage Repair Process Works
We understand that water damage can be a stressful and overwhelming experience, especially with navigating insurance claims and restoration costs. That’s why we’ve developed a straightforward process that takes the guesswork out of water damage repair. From initial assessment to final completion, our team will guide you every step of the way.
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our trained technicians will arrive at your property within 60 minutes to assess the damage and identify the source of the problem.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and ensure that all affected areas are accounted for.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Removal
Our powerful pumps and vacuums will extract the standing water from your property, and our technicians will carefully remove any saturated materials, such as drywall and carpeting. We’ll also use industrial-grade fans to speed up the drying process.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use advanced equipment to dry your property thoroughly, including dehumidifiers and air movers. We’ll also monitor the moisture levels to ensure that your property is completely dry before moving on to the next step.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once your property is dry, our technicians will thoroughly clean and sanitize all aff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. We’ll also use specialized equipment to remove any remaining moisture and odors.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Our team will work with you to restore your property to its original condition, including repairing or replacing any damaged materials. We’ll also help you navigate the insurance claims process to ensure that you receive the compensation you deserve.

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) | Yes | No | You can clean it up yourself with a mop and some towels. |
| Large water spill (over 1 gallon) | No | Yes | It’s too much for you to handle on your own, and it could lead to further damage. |
| Hidden moisture behind walls or ceilings | No | Yes | You can’t see the damage, and it’s likely to spread if left unchecked. |
| M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| It’s a health risk, and it needs specialized equipment and expertise to remove. |
| Water damage to electrical systems or appliances | No | Yes | It’s a safety risk, and it needs specialized knowledge and equipment to repair. |

Water Damage Repair Cost in Claremore, OK
The cost of water damage repair can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, amount of moisture, and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of materials, and equipment needed |
| Restoration and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ials, and labor required |
| Insurance claims help | $0 – $500 | Complexity of claim, documentation required, and time spent on claim |
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ost of water damage repair will depend on your specific situation and property.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ing your property.
